About Semiconductor Sector Service Bureau (S3B)
The Semiconductor Sector Service Bureau (S3B) was established in July 2022 with funding from the NSW Government through the Office of the Chief Scientist & Engineer to enhance the capability, workforce, market connectedness and competitiveness of the NSW and Australian semiconductor sector. S3B is hosted as a joint venture between The University of Sydney (USyd), Macquarie University (MQ) and UNSW Sydney (UNSW). The entire consortium, in partnership with the CSIRO, the Australian National Fabrication Facility (ANFF) and participants from across the Australian semiconductor industry, represents a globally networked, cross-functional grouping that spans the semiconductor value chain. S3B is funded annually by the NSW Government and the host universities. S3B is working at the nexus between industry, universities and government to increase the commercial impact of semiconductors by building capacity, connectivity and collaboration throughout the sector. To enable the increased participation of NSW and Australia in the global semiconductor supply chain S3B will perform 4 key functions: 1. Broker on behalf of many Australian projects to consolidate the potential of collective relationships with the semiconductor supply chain. 2. Offer a strategic and functional semiconductor market intelligence capability. 3. Promote and facilitate access to semiconductor micro-credentialled training to address skill gaps identified in the industry. 4. Coordinate and foster collaboration in the semiconductor sector in NSW and Australia.
